New Tiny Primate Species Discovered in 50-Million-Year-Old Wyoming Sandstone! (2026)

The recent discovery of a tiny new primate species, Tetonius varleyorum, from 50-million-year-old sandstone in Wyoming, is a fascinating development in paleontology. This find not only adds a new chapter to the story of North America's best-studied fossil lineage, the omomyids, but also challenges existing scientific ideas about their evolution. A Rare Find, Indeed

What makes Tetonius varleyorum particularly notable is the company it keeps. Alongside this new species, the same site yielded two other rare omomyid primates, Arapahovius gazini and Anemorhysis savage, each of which had only been documented a handful of times before. The presence of three separate species of these small primates at a single early Eocene site is unprecedented, and a fourth omomyid, not yet formally described, was also recovered.

Challenging Established Theories

The discovery also challenges established theories about the evolution of Tetonius. A landmark 1987 paper by Thomas Bown and Kenneth Rose claimed that there was no branching of the Tetonius tree, with no speciation events. This theory, known as anagenesis, posited a linear progression from one intermediate species to the next. However, the new fossils of Tetonius varleyorum interrupt this purported anagenetic lineage.

This finding has significant implications for our understanding of macroevolutionary patterns among anaptomorphines. It suggests that the evolutionary tree may be more complex than previously thought, with multiple branching events and potential convergent evolution. The Role of Fossil Sites

The site in Wyoming, known as Smiley Draw, is a crucial one for paleontological research. It has already produced nearly 1,000 tooth-bearing jaw fragments representing a wide range of ancient mammals. The fact that this site has yielded such a diverse array of fossils, including multiple rare species, underscores its importance in advancing our knowledge of ancient ecosystems.

However, the paper also emphasizes the need to consider fossils from outside the better-sampled Bighorn Basin. By incorporating fossils from different locales, scientists can gain a more nuanced understanding of the evolutionary story. This approach challenges the assumption that the Bighorn Basin is the only source of relevant information, and it highlights the importance of diverse fossil sites in shaping our understanding of the past.
